Study on apoptosis of PC12 cell by manganese chloride and its mechanism

Abstract
Objective To explore the possible mechanism of manganese-induced apoptosis in PC12 cells.Methods Using PC12 cells as the model of dopaminergic neuron,MTT colorimetry test was used to detect the growth and survival state of PC12 cells in various doses of manganese chloride;apoptosis was detected by flow cytometry(FCM)and agarose gel electrophoresis(AGE);and immunocytochemistry was used to measure the expression and location of HSP70,Survivin,Bcl-2 and Bax.Results The results shown that manganese might suppress the proliferation of PC12 cells in dose and time-dependent manner,and might dose-dependently induce PC12 cells apoptosis;manganese chloride might also promote the expression of Bax in dose-dependent manners,which had a positive correlation to PC12 cells apoptosis(R1=0.972,P0.01);additionally,manganese chloride might dose-dependently inhibited the expression of HSP70,Survivin and Bcl-2 in PC12 cells as well,which had a negative correlation to PC12 cell apoptosis(R2=-0.990,R3=-0.976,R4=-0.980,P0.01).Conclusions Manganese can induce PC12 cells apoptosis,the enhanced expressions of Bax and the prohibited expressions of HSP70,Survivin,Bcl-2 may be the concrete pathway involved the mechanism of manganese-induced apoptosis of PC12 cells.
